struct.h

来自「MCS51的实现无线接收发送(315M或433M)源程序代码。」· C头文件 代码 · 共 61 行

H
61
字号
/**********************************************************
*                  Struct.h                               *
**********************************************************/
#ifndef STRUCTH
#define STRUCTH 1
//=========================================================
typedef unsigned char  BOOLEAN;
typedef unsigned char  INT8U;
typedef unsigned int   INT16U; 
typedef unsigned long  INT32U;

typedef BOOLEAN idata  BOOLEANI;
typedef BOOLEAN xdata  BOOLEANX;
typedef INT8U idata    INT8UI;
typedef INT8U xdata    INT8UX;
typedef INT16U idata   INT16UI;
typedef INT16U xdata   INT16UX;
typedef INT32U idata   INT32UI;
typedef INT32U xdata   INT32UX;
typedef INT8U code     INT8UC;
typedef INT16U code    INT16UC;
typedef INT32U code    INT32UC;

typedef float xdata    FLOATX;
//=========================================================
typedef struct
{
   INT8U TskId;
   INT8U MsgId;
   INT16U Para;
}TskMsgStruct;
//=========================================================
typedef struct
{
   INT8U TskId;
   INT8U MsgId;
   INT16U Para;
}MsgStruct;
//=========================================================
typedef struct
{
   INT16UX *Head;
   INT16UX *Tail;
   INT8U   Item;
}QueStruct;
//=========================================================
typedef struct
{
   INT8U  *KeyWord;
   INT16U ExecAddr;
}KeyEntryStruct;
//=========================================================
#define NULL  0XFFFF
#define TRUE  1
#define true  1
#define FALSE 0
#define false 0
//=========================================================
#endif
//=========================================================

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?